The first step in filing a suit is to sue the makers of asbestos-containing products. Lawyers for mesothelioma can also file claims with government agencies like the VA and workers compensation. The specific deadlines for filing claims are different.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ist you in determining the best timeline for your particular situation.
Discovery begins when the defendants have responded to the lawsuit. During the process of discovery, both parties can seek documents or depositions (written in person, in person or virtually). Mesothelioma lawyers will utilize the evidence gathered to negotiate with defendants on your behalf.
Mesothelioma compensation is made up of a variety of types of damages, which include lost wages, medical expenses and suffering and pain. The amount of lost earnings a mesothelioma patient can expect to receive is contingent on the severity of their condition and how long they were absent from work.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ist determine the total amount lost by collecting pay stubs from a variety of years including bank statements, stubs, and tax returns.
The amount of reimbursement for medical expenses will depend on what kind of mesothelioma the patient is suffering from, as well as the treatment options available. Patients with malignant mesothelioma could be treated through chemotherapy, surgery, or radiation therapy. Patients with peritoneal mesothelioma which affects the abdominal lining, can be treated with surgery and chemotherapy but are less likely receive radiation therapy as it can damage healthy tissues.

A mesothelioma lawyer may assist victims in collecting important evidence to show that asbestos-related companies are accountable for their disease. Evidence could include asbestos-related health records, interview transcripts, mesothelioma test results and the location of workplaces where workers were exposed to asbestos. Mesothelioma lawyers will then file the suit in the appropriate court and state and attempt to settle the case prior to the time that any time limit expires.
Settlements, trial verdicts, or trust fund awards may solve mesothelioma lawsuits. Each method has its own pros and cons. A m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ced will review each option to determine which one is most beneficial for the client's situation.
